Dam of the City Pond on the Iset River

The name “Plotinka” is known among local residents. The dam was completed in 1723. In 1998, a pedestrian tunnel was laid in a side section. The side walls of the dam are decorated with bas-reliefs. City festivals are held in the square near the dam; in summer you can enjoy a light show by the fountain. The Historical Square is adjacent to the dam. It houses old buildings, art objects, a monument to de Gennin and Tatishchev, a "rock garden".

Sevastyanov's house

The striking and ornate building next to the dam is one of the city's most recognizable architectural symbols. The house was built in 1817 and stands out with a semicircular rotunda at the corner of the house. In the 19th century, the new owner, Sevastyanov, added baroque and neo-Gothic decorative elements to the classic appearance of the house. During the renovation, the house, which looks more like a palace, was returned to a festive color scheme of green, white and red.

Observation deck of the business center "Vysotsky"

The Vysotsky skyscraper was built in the city center and before the construction of the Iset tower was the tallest building in the city. The observation deck of the business center is located on the 52nd floor - 186 meters above the ground. It offers a wonderful panoramic view of the city. The main sights of the city are especially clearly visible - the City Pond and its dam, the Church on the Blood, the Yeltsin Center. Lake Shartash is visible in clear weather.

Weiner street

Uralsky Arbat is a pedestrian street in the city, which is always lively and crowded. One of the oldest streets in the city was first mentioned in documents in the 1740s. Many architectural monuments on it are protected by the state. For hundreds of years the street has retained its commercial value. There are many small shops and large shopping centers here. The original monuments to Michael Jackson and Gene Bukin have been erected.

Yekaterinburg-City

A business district designed to combine commercial areas, hotels, entertainment centers. The construction of all the planned buildings has not yet been completed, but the complex is already a visiting card of the Urals business. Tall and stylish buildings of modern architecture look great against the backdrop of the City Pond. The Iset Tower is 212 meters high. The complex includes the Hyatt Regency hotel and the Demidov business house.

Central Park of Culture and Leisure named after V.V. Mayakovsky

A large park for active leisure and outdoor recreation. The total area of ​​the park is 90 hectares, of which 70 hectares are forest. More than 2.5 million people visit it annually. Themed walkways with sculptures are laid in the park - Newlyweds Alley, Retro Alley, Literary Alley. There is an area with attractions, a contact mini-zoo, a rope park, a park with dinosaurs. The park is decorated with a light and music fountain.

International Arts Center "Glavny Prospekt"

Opened in 2018. The center has united within its walls halls with exhibitions of painting and sculpture, an exposition of minerals, a Museum of Local Lore and a venue for concerts. The cultural urban space covers an area of ​​more than 2,000 square meters, where a large number of significant events in Yekaterinburg are held. The center hosts permanent exhibitions POP Art, Alvitr Gallery, Gutenberg, and works by Andy Warhol.

United Museum of Ural Writers

Literary Memorial Museum, which made it possible to create events of a new format, combining theatrical and literary arts. It includes several branches, some of which form the Literary Quarter. This is a unique place in the city center, where you can feel yourself in the 19th century on excursions among the monuments of wooden architecture. On the site, the museums have recreated carriage sheds and a stable.

Temple on blood

The largest temple in Yekaterinburg, built on the site of the Ipatiev house, where the royal family was shot. The five-domed temple consists of two levels in different styles. The upper one is light, with many windows. The lower one is semi-gloomy, with a crypt, where the execution room is recreated. At the temple there is a heartfelt monument to the royal family - they are depicted at the time of descent into the basement for execution. The Museum of the Royal Family is located next to the temple.

"Red line"

The red line on the pavement appeared in 2011. She leads tourists to the most interesting and iconic places of the city. The self-guided walking tour is 6.5 km long. About 11,000 people voted to determine the best sights of the city. There are 35 objects in the list of places on the route. On the website of the Red Line route you can download the audio guide in Russian and English.

Working Youth Embankment

The old street of the city, founded in 1919, runs along the right bank of the City Pond. Its length is 2 km. There are a lot of historical architectural monuments on the embankment - the building of the men's gymnasium, the house of the merchant Pshenichnikov, the house of the head of the mining plants of the Urals. The Yeltsin Center, the Iset Tower are clearly visible, the Iset Olympic Embankment is visible on the opposite side.

Museum of the History of Stone Cutting and Jewelry Art

Located in a 19th century building. Its extensive collections feature works by original Ural masters of the 1920s-1930s. The guides talk about the activities of the Russian Gems Factory, the traditions of the Imperial Lapidary Factory in Yekaterinburg, the history of Russian jewelry art since the 9th century. There is an exposition of mineral stones, works of modern jewelry and stone-cutting art.

Museum of the History of Yekaterinburg

Founded in the 1940s. Occupies several old buildings on Karl Liebknecht Street. The main building was built in 1840 and is a historical and cultural monument. The permanent exhibition of the museum tells about the history of Yekaterinburg, the streets of the old city, the natural wealth of rivers and lands. The archaeological exhibition tells about the first metallurgists of the region, shows artifacts from the 3rd-7th centuries BC.

Yekaterinburg Museum of Fine Arts

An art gallery spanning two buildings. Among the permanent exhibitions of the museum are Russian icon painting and painting of the 17th-20th centuries, works of decorative and applied art by Ural masters, Kasli casting, collections of porcelain and glass, products of the Tobolsk folk bone. The works of Malevich, Savrasov, Levitan, Shishkin are exhibited.A separate subdivision tells about naive art, graphics, painting, sculpture are exhibited.

Sverdlovsk Regional Museum of Local Lore

Founded in 1870. The main thematic expositions are the nature of the Ural region, archeology, numismatics, ethnography, architectural and artistic history of the region. A unique exhibit is a wooden sculpture of the Great Shigir Idol, whose age, according to scientists, is more than 9000 years. In total, the funds of the branches of the museum have more than 700,000 exhibits. About 270,000 people visit it annually.

Museum of the Sverdlovsk Railway

It is located in a beautiful building of the Old Railway Station of 1878, decorated in a pseudo-Russian style. Visitors to the museum will learn about the history and development of the Ural railway, see old exhibits, models of railway stations, a collection of models of steam locomotives and trains. On the square in front of the museum, there are sculptures of railway workers from different eras. The original composition is the sculptural group "Passengers".

Photographic Museum "Metenkov's House"

It is located in the house of the famous photo-chronicler Metenkov. For 40 years, he traveled around the Urals, compiling photographic evidence of the passing time. The museum's expositions tell about the history of the development of photography in Yekaterinburg over the past 150 years. The oldest photo of the museum dates back to 1863. The room is designed as a photo studio. It hosts lectures, master classes, and creative meetings.

Boris Yeltsin Presidential Center

Community center located near the Yekaterinburg center. The main cultural object is the museum of the first president of Russia, Boris Yeltsin. It tells about the political life of the country and the personality of Boris Nikolaevich. Its 9 rooms are decorated using modern multimedia technologies, there are many interactive exhibitions. The opening of the center was attended by V. Putin, D. Medvedev, N. Yeltsin.

The building of the Sverdlovsk City Council

The regional architectural monument is located on the 1905 square. The square is covered with paving stones, recreating its historical image in the 19th century. In the center of the square there is a monument to V.I. Lenin. Construction of the City Council building began at the end of the 19th century. The building received its final architectural appearance in the Stalinist Empire style in the 1940s. Design features - columns, monumental panel "Victory Salute".

Estate of the Rastorguev-Kharitonovs

An architectural monument that adorns the center of Yekaterinburg. The estate is located on Voznesenskaya Hill, which offers an excellent view of the iconic places of the city. The estate was built from 1794 to 1824. Its buildings have a classicism style. The asymmetrical composition and the corner house give the facade of the building from the central side an original look. Architects Malakhov and Adamini took part in the construction of the estate.

White Tower at Uralmash

Former water tower, built in 1931. It is 29 meters high. The hydrotechnical structure is an architectural monument of constructivism and an unofficial symbol of the Uralmash region. Thanks to the actions of public funds, the tower did not collapse after decommissioning. Theatrical performances and media panorama are shown at its converted venues.

"Town of Chekists"

An architectural complex from 1929-1936, consisting of 14 buildings. The constructivist-style monument occupies a block of buildings commissioned by the NKVD-OGPU. The command staff of this organization lived in them, which is why the quarter got its name among the people. Inside the commune there were also premises for outside work. The outer perimeter of the quarter had only two gates; you could get inside only with passes.

House of the Chief Mining Chief

The federal architectural monument of the early 19th century was built by the architect Melekhov. He reconstructed the already existing mansion of the berg-inspector Bulgakov, adding decorative details to it. The front of the house, facing the pond, is decorated with a mezzanine and a portico. An arcade is laid between the first and second floors, a colonnade is located just above. The third tier of the portico is made up of thin Corinthian columns.

Opera and Ballet Theatre

Founded in 1912. The theater building is a historical monument. When creating his project, the architect was inspired by the opera buildings in Odessa and Vienna. The facade of the theater is decorated with balconies with balustrades, stucco moldings, sculptures of muses. The hall can accommodate 914 spectators, there are several categories of seats. Performances are shown every day. The repertoire includes about 20 opera and 20 ballet performances. The theater troupe often tours.

Kolyada Theater

It was founded in 2001 and has shown performances on the stages of other theaters for several years. Since 2014, the performances of the Kolyada Theater can be seen within the walls of the former Iskra cinema. The main auditorium is designed for 124 seats, the chamber hall - for 50. The theater troupe consists of 40 people. The repertoire includes performances for different age categories, it should be borne in mind that most of them are limited to 18+.

Sverdlovsk Philharmonic

Created in 1936. It is housed in a magnificent 1915 classicist building with neo-Gothic elements. The concert hall can accommodate 700 spectators, the chamber hall - 120 spectators. The halls contain unique grand pianos and a 4120 pipe organ. The Philharmonic has organized ensembles of Russian folk instruments, a symphonic choir, a trio of accordionists and concert performers. In total, 197 artists work in the Philharmonic.

Circus named after V.I.Filatov

The openwork dome of the circus on the western bank of the Iset can be seen from afar. Its height is 50 meters. The architecture of the building allows performing complex numbers within its walls. Both children and adults watch circus programs with pleasure. The performances involve artists of different circus genres - clowns, trainers, acrobats. Famous circus groups of the country and the world perform on the arena and hold festivals.

Yekaterinburg arboretum

Consists of two parks. The park on Pervomayskaya Street was founded in 1932. On the site of a pine forest near two lakes, about 300 species of plants from Siberia, the Far East, and North America have been planted. The first rose garden of the Urals is also located here, in which about 100 species of roses grow. Since 1948, a park on 8 Marta Street has been operating with an area of ​​7.5 hectares. It is designed in the style of regular French parks. A fountain has been installed, there is a winter garden.

Kharitonovsky Garden

Founded on the site of an English garden, laid out at the Rastorguev-Kharitonov estate in 1826. The natural landscape inherent in the English park style will bring coziness and comfort to the garden, which makes it one of the favorite places for walking among city residents. In the center of the garden there is an artificial lake, on the island of which there is an elegant rotunda. In the depths of the park, there is an old stone grotto where wines were kept.

Park "Green Grove"

Founded in the 18th century. The Green Grove was located on the territory of the Novo-Tikhvinsky Monastery. The quiet and cozy monastery grove was loved by the residents of the city as a place for quiet walks. The territory of the modern park is 24 hectares. It is dominated by coniferous trees. In the shady alleys, you can find squirrels who gladly accept delicacies. Children's and sports grounds are equipped.

Victory Park

Located in a forest near Lake Shuvakish. The forest consists of birches and pines. The forested area is used for walking and sports. Treadmills were laid, horizontal bars and exercise equipment were installed, sports grounds were equipped.There is an area with gazebos and barbecues. There is a bicycle and ATV rental point, a rope park. You can fish in the lake. In winter, the skating rink is flooded and the Christmas tree is decorated.

Sports complex "Uktus"

The ski complex is popular not only among the residents of Yekaterinburg, but also among the guests of the city. From the slopes of the mountains you can ski, snowboard, tubing and snowmobiles. The snowpark is equipped with two jumps, railings and a 6-meter spine. There is a sports school for children. In the summer, an amusement park is open, there is a rental of bicycles, gyro scooters, pit bikes. The thermal complex is open all year round.

Monastery of the Holy Royal Passion-Bearers

Among pilgrims and tourists, the place is also known as Ganina Yama. In this place, in the mine of the mine, the remains of the executed royal family in 1918 were originally buried. In 2000, a monastery was founded in the tract. About 300,000 people visit it annually. The monastery consists of seven wooden churches. Monuments to members of the royal family have been erected. The territory of the monastery is beautiful, the buildings are located among tall pines.

Temple of the Lord's Ascension

The construction of the stone church began in 1789 on the site of an old dilapidated church. It is considered the oldest temple in Yekaterinburg. The majestic temple is located on Voskresnaya Gorka - in one of the most picturesque places in the city. The rare Baroque temple is solemnly beautiful - its sky-blue walls are combined with white decorative elements and golden domes. The temple is decorated with a high bell tower.

Temple Big Chrysostom

The bell tower, reconstructed in 2006-2013. The temple is made in the classic Byzantine style. The unique layout makes the building an interesting architectural object. Initially, the bell tower was supposed to be located at the entrance to a detached temple. However, due to a lack of funds, the main building of the temple was never built, and the bell tower was consecrated as a temple. Its bell ringing can be heard far away on the streets of the city.

Novo-Tikhvin monastery

Convent, founded in 1809. It is considered one of the largest in Russia. Has two farmsteads - Elizavetinskoe and Svyato-Simeonovskoe. The main temple of the monastery is the Alexander Nevsky Cathedral. It was built in the style of late classicism in 1838-1854. The sisters of the monastery are actively involved in the work of the famous icon-painting workshop, a publishing house, a charitable canteen, and a spiritual and educational center.

Holy Trinity Cathedral

The main temple of the city is located in the center of the city. Built in the 19th century. The luxurious cathedral is made in a classical architectural style. Unusual is the yellow color of the walls, over which gilded domes shine. The bell tower of the cathedral consists of three tiers. On Easter days, anyone can climb it and try themselves in the role of a church bell ringer. The inner walls of the temple are painted in bright yellow and blue colors.

Monument to Tatishchev and de Gennin

The monument to the founders of the city was erected at the dam of the City Pond. The monument was opened in 1998, the year of the celebration of the 275th anniversary of Yekaterinburg. The bronze sculptures were made at the Uralmash plant. The author of the project is P.P. Chusovitin. The figures are depicted in full growth, they are standing next to each other. The figures are similar to each other, which is why they are often confused. Among the inhabitants of the city, the monument received the humorous name "Beavis and Butthead".

Monument to the keyboard

Sculpture in the style of land art on the city embankment. Included in the list of the most visited attractions in the city. It is a concrete copy of a computer keyboard at a scale of 1:30. It includes 104 keys, the heaviest space bar weighs 500 kg. The total size of the entire monument is 16 * 4 meters. The unusual monument was visited by the author of one of the first programming languages ​​"Pascal" - Niklaus Wirth.

Monument to the group "The Beatles"

The monument to the British group was erected not far from the keyboard monument. The sculptural composition has an unusual appearance. The figures of the musicians are made in the form of silhouettes against the background of a brick wall. The brick wall was decorated with graffiti works dedicated to the work of the Liverpool quartet. A black platform is placed in front of the figures to represent the stage. The unveiling of the monument was attended by the group The Quarrymen, founded by Lennon.

Monument to Vladimir Vysotsky and Marina Vladi

Located at the entrance to the Antey mall opposite the hotel where Vysotsky lived during his tour in Yekaterinburg. Vysotsky is depicted playing the guitar for his wife Marina Vlady. The creators first agreed on the idea of ​​the monument with Vysotsky's son Nikita. The bronze figures are cast in full height. The opening of the monument in 2006 was attended by actors Zolotukhin and Filippenko, as well as the mayor of the city of Chernetsky.

Obelisk on the border between Europe and Asia

A 30-meter red granite obelisk was erected 17 km from Yekaterinburg, symbolizing the conditional border between the two parts of the world. It is surrounded by beautiful flower beds and cozy gazebos. The obelisk was first erected in 1837 for the arrival of the emperor. It was destroyed during the Civil War, but then a new one was installed - already without the emblem of the eagle at the top. In 2008, the obelisk was moved to another place - closer to the city of Novouralsk.

Verkh-Isetsky pond

An artificial reservoir formed in the 1720s to provide water to a nearby plant. The area of ​​the pond is 16 km², the maximum depth is 2.5 meters. The most popular swimming area is located near the yacht club. The entrance to the water is shallow. There is a pier, boat rental and catamarans. The most comfortable beach is considered to be on the Big Horse Peninsula - there is an outdoor pool, gazebos with barbecue facilities, and a playground with animators.

Shartash stone tents

A unique natural monument within the city. It is a bizarre rock formations reaching a height of 12 meters, and together with a hill - 25 meters. The age of these unusual rocks is 300 million years. The forest area around the Stone Tents is landscaped and is a popular walking area. A stone amphitheater is built next to the natural monument, harmoniously blending into the natural landscape.

Lake Shartash

The lake was formed about 1 million years ago. Located next to the Stone Tents. The area around the lake is equipped for comfortable outdoor recreation. Hiking and cycling paths are laid among the forest, there are areas with gazebos and barbecues, a landscaped beach, a boat station, houses for living. You can rent gear and arrange fishing. Entertainment - rope town, shooting range, laser tag, baths.
